>Now, kclist_add() only eats start address and size as its arguments.
>Considering to make kclist dynamically reconfigulable, it's necessary
>to know which kclists are for System RAM and whic is not.
>
>This patch add kclist types as
> KCORE_RAM
> KCORE_VMALLOC
> KCORE_TEXT
> KCORE_OTHER
>
>region for KCORE_RAM will be dynamically updated at memory hotplug.


The idea is good, but will it be used in any of your latter patches?
I don't see it, can you point it out?

>Index: mmotm-2.6.31-Jul16/include/linux/proc_fs.h
>===================================================================
>--- mmotm-2.6.31-Jul16.orig/include/linux/proc_fs.h
>+++ mmotm-2.6.31-Jul16/include/linux/proc_fs.h
>@@ -78,10 +78,18 @@ struct proc_dir_entry {
> struct list_head pde_openers; /* who did ->open, but not ->release */
> };
>
>+enum kcore_type {
>+ KCORE_TEXT,
>+ KCORE_VMALLOC,
>+ KCORE_RAM,
>+ KCORE_OTHER,
>+};
>+
> struct kcore_list {
> struct list_head list;
> unsigned long addr;
> size_t size;
>+ int type;
> };
>
> struct vmcore {
>@@ -233,11 +241,12 @@ static inline void dup_mm_exe_file(struc
> #endif /* CONFIG_PROC_FS */
>
> #if !defined(CONFIG_PROC_KCORE)
>-static inline void kclist_add(struct kcore_list *new, void *addr, size_t size)
>+static inline void
>+kclist_add(struct kcore_list *new, void *addr, size_t size, int type)
> {
> }
> #else
>-extern void kclist_add(struct kcore_list *, void *, size_t);
>+extern void kclist_add(struct kcore_list *, void *, size_t, int type);
> #endif
>
